Внутривидовая изменчивость Puccinia triticina на гексаплоидных видах Triticum и Aegilops trivialis

Аннотация
Анализ внутривидовой дифференциации патогена – необходимый этап при разработке стратегии селекции пшеницы на устойчивость к бурой ржавчине. Для характеристики популяций Puccinia triticina Erikss. могут быть использованы разные признаки, включая вирулентность к линиям серии Thatcher с генами устойчивости к бурой ржавчине (TcLr) и молекулярные маркеры. Цель работы – изучение внутривидовой изменчивости гриба P. triticina на гексаплоидных видах Triticum L. и Aegilops trivialis (Zhuk.) Migusch. et Chak. с помощью SSR-маркеров. Листья образцов гексаплоид- ных видов Triticum aestivum L., T. compactum Host., T. macha Dekapr. et Menabde, T. petropavlovskyi Udacz. et Migusch., T. spelta L., T. sphaerococcum Perc., T. vavilovii Jakubz. (геном BВAuAuDD), Ae. trivialis (геном Dc Dc DDМM) с урединиопустулами собирали на Дагестанской опытной станции ВИР (г. Дербент) в 2014 г. Для SSR-анализа использовали 109 монопустульных изолятов гриба, ранее охарактеризованных по вирулентности к 20 TcLr-линиям. Изучение полиморфизма 18 микросателлитных локусов позволило выявить 16 SSR-генотипов. Генетическое сходство между коллекциями изолятов с гексаплоидных видов пшеницы по молекулярным маркерам было существенно выше, чем по признаку вирулентности. Показано высокое генетическое сходство между дербентскими изолятами P. triticina, полученными с гексаплоидных видов родов Triticum (в том числе и мягкой пшеницы) и Ae. trivialis.
